Warning Signs You Need Ceiling Water Damage Repair

Ignoring these signs can cost you more. It can lead to bigger problems. It can make your home unsafe. It can cause mold. It can damage your walls and structure. You need to act fast. You need to know what to look for. It’s not always obvious. But it’s there. It’s worth checking. It’s worth fixing.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A damp, moldy smell is a sign of hidden water damage. It can come from behind the drywall. It can linger even after you clean. It’s not just bad air. It’s a health risk. It’s a sign of mold. It’s a sign you need help. It’s a sign you don’t want to ignore.

Water Stains or Sagging Ceiling

Dark spots or sagging areas are clear signs of water damage. They can be hidden. They can start small. They can grow fast. They can cause structural issues. They can lead to collapse. It’s important to act quickly. It’s important to get it fixed. It’s not something you can ignore.

Peeling Paint or Bubbling Wallpaper

Paint that peels or wallpaper that bubbles is a sign of moisture. It can be from a leak. It can be from condensation. It can be from a hidden source. It can lead to more damage. It can cause mold. It’s not just a cosmetic issue. It’s a sign of a bigger problem. It’s a sign you need to fix it.

Increased Humidity in Your Home

Higher than normal humidity can mean hidden water. It can be from a leak. It can be from a condensation problem. It can be from a plumbing issue. It can cause mold. It can damage your home. It can make your home uncomfortable. It’s a sign you need to check the ceiling. It’s a sign you need to act.

Visible Mold Growth

Mold is a serious health risk. It can grow in hidden areas. It can spread quickly. It can cause allergies. It can damage your home. It can be expensive to fix. It’s a sign of water damage. It’s a sign you need to call a professional. It’s a sign you can’t ignore.

Unexplained Dampness or Water Puddles

Water puddles or damp spots on the floor are a red flag. They can come from a leak. They can come from a plumbing problem. They can be hidden. They can cause more damage. They can lead to mold. They can be dangerous. It’s a sign you need to act. It’s a sign you need help.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spot on the ceiling Yes No It might be easy but it can hide more damage. You might not see the full extent.
Leak from a pipe or roof No Yes It’s a structural issue. It can cause more damage if not fixed right.
Visible mold growth No Yes Mold is a health risk. It needs professional cleaning and removal.
Large area of sagging ceiling No Yes It can be dangerous. It might need structural repairs.
Water under the drywall No Yes It can lead to mold. It needs proper drying and inspection.
Insurance claim required No Yes It’s easier with a professional handling the process.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ost In Carrboro, NC

Costs vary based on the damage. The size of the area matters. The type of damage matters. The extent of the water damage matters. These are estimates. They’re not guarantees. You need to get an on-site assessment. It’s the only way to know for sure. It’s the only way to get an accurate price.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$300 – $1,200 Amount of water, location, and drying time
Structural Repairs $500 – $2,500 Extent of damage, materials used, and labor
Mold Removal $750 – $3,000 Size of mold, type, and area affected
Painting and Finishing $200 – $1,000 Size of area, complexity, and materials
Insurance Claim Help Free Our team helps with documentation and communication
Emergency Response $150 – $500 Time of day, urgency, and availability

Common Questions About Ceiling Water Damage Repair

How much does ceiling water damage repair cost?

It depends on the damage. The size of the area and the type of damage matter. You can expect to pay between $300 and $3,000. It’s best to get a free estimate. It’s the best way to know. It’s the best way to plan. It’s the best way to move forward.

How long does it take to fix ceiling water damage?

It can take 3-5 days. It depends on the damage. It depends on the size of the area. It depends on the drying process. It’s important to act fast. It’s important to get it done right. It’s important to make sure it’s done thoroughly.

Can water damage lead to mold?

Yes. It can. Mold can grow in as little as 24 hours. It’s a health risk. It’s a structural risk. It’s a risk you don’t want. It’s important to act fast. It’s important to get it fixed. It’s important to prevent it from spreading.

What equipment do you use for ceiling water damage repair?

We use extractors, dehumidifiers, and air movers. We use moisture meters. We use professional-grade tools. We do it right. We do it thoroughly. We do it fast. It’s the only way to make sure it’s done properly.

How can I prevent ceiling water damage?

Check for leaks regularly. Keep your roof in good condition. Fix plumbing issues. Keep humidity levels low. Inspect your home. It’s the best way to prevent damage. It’s the best way to protect your home. It’s the best way to avoid costly repairs.
